News summary

Dele Alli has signed an 18-month contract with Serie A club Como, marking his return to top-flight football after a challenging period following his release from Everton. The 28-year-old, who previously played on loan at Besiktas, is expected to help revive his career with the support of Como's management, including head coach Cesc Fabregas. Despite his struggles in recent years, including mental health issues and a significant decline in form, Alli's experience is seen as valuable for the squad, particularly for mentoring younger players. Como currently sits just above the relegation zone and hopes Alli can contribute positively as they prepare to face Udinese. The club's focus will be on integrating Alli gradually without immediate performance pressures. This move represents a significant opportunity for Alli to regain his footing in professional football.
